We gratefully acknowledge those on … WebApr 5, 2024 · Bipolar affective disorder (BPAD) is one of the most common severe mental illnesses that cause morbidity. Stigma can negatively influence the disease experience in patients with BPAD. Significant differences are observed in the attributes of stigma across the various sociocultural milieus.

WebJan 31, 2024 · Bipolar Affective Disorder (BPAD) is a chronic, recurrent cyclical mood disorder associated with high levels of suffering, occupational dysfunction, impaired social life and relationships, as well as increased morbidity and mortality. BPAD is often co-morbid with a range of other mental disorders (for example, psychosis, substance misuse ...
